Transaction 8072bd494d1a1757b76e76e664042f1b005dc8ae619b323455813ea20a85ac9a

3 Input
2 Outputs
  • 8072bd494d1a1757b76e76e664042f1b005dc8ae619b323455813ea20a85ac9a:0
  • value  6591200
    address  3FqWqmjh34eZMmWDmLGkb8VVMtcDtEwSND
  • 8072bd494d1a1757b76e76e664042f1b005dc8ae619b323455813ea20a85ac9a:1
  • value  46856
    address  bc1quhdype4ff8eqsnmu9wx2edvqfwu4gzx0fyhgtw